The Delhi cabinet has approved the draft Delhi Geospatial Data Infrastructure Bill, 2011 – a flagship project of the city government launched to frame and implement policies for issues relating to geospatial data. The Bill will serve as the base for planning and executing various development projects and utility services.
The Delhi government is gearing up to complete the exercise of giving out the “Aadhar” numbers by October this year, with poor families set to get their Unique Identification Numbers ( UID) first.
